    Removing the mold does not avoid the damage of mold. Although we can't detect it with the naked eye, the remaining parts that don't look moldy have been immersed in various harmful substances produced by microbial metabolism, and it is difficult for us to accurately estimate the extent of the spread with the naked eye, so it is best not to eat it. Missing mold.

    In addition, mold produces cytotoxins, and the cytotoxins will spread to the inside of the food, and we cannot tell with the naked eye exactly which part of the food it has spread. Therefore, if the food is moldy, it is better to throw it away whole!

    Moldy ham is inedible.

    For the reasons of the food itself, such as incomplete food sterilization, dry food is not fully dried, etc., in the environment of trace oxygen or high humidity, microorganisms multiply, which is easy to lead to mold, mildew, and bag expansion. Unqualified outer packaging can allow oxygen or water vapor to enter the finished package, promote the reproduction of microorganisms, and lead to mold, mildew and bag expansion of food.

    The root cause of food mold problems is the growth of microorganisms. As we all know, microorganisms have a strong ability to grow and reproduce in an environment with sufficient nutrients, water and oxygen, and the fat, protein and other components contained in food provide good nutritional conditions for the reproduction of microorganisms.

    No. Here's why:

    The production of ham is divided into refurbishment, curing, washing and drying, shaping, fermentation, stacking, grading and other processes, and the production cycle of good quality ham takes about 10 months. Ham curing has strict requirements for temperature conditions, which vary from stage to stage. Among them, the suitable temperature in the curing stage should be lower than 8 °C, so the curing time must be carried out in winter; The temperature at the end of the fermentation stage must be maintained at 28°C and 35°C; The temperature in the warehouse should be below 30 °C during the preservation period, and cooling measures must be taken in the high temperature season, otherwise it will change the taste, drip oil, and affect the quality.

    If the temperature and humidity of the ham are too high at the end of the fermentation stage and during the storage period, the surface of the ham will become moldy. However, the growth of a small amount of mold on the surface will not affect the intrinsic quality of the ham, if the surface of this layer of mold is scraped off, the muscle section is dark rose, pink or dark red, the fat is white, light yellow or light red, with gloss, the tissue is strong and dense, elastic, the acupressure depression can be recovered immediately, basically no traces, the cut surface is smooth, smooth, and has the unique aroma of normal ham, the ham can still be eaten normally. If it has a rancid or hala taste, it should not be eaten.
